Detailed explanation-1: -You intend to use a different quote on each slide, but you want to use the same font style and box size for all quotes. Which method is the most efficient way for you to do this? Add the text box and set the font style using the slide master.

Detailed explanation-4: -Placeholders are the dotted-line containers on slide layouts that hold such content as titles, body text, tables, charts, SmartArt graphics, pictures, clip art, videos, and sounds.
